Variety: Sagrantino di Montefalco is produced in two forms: Montefalco Sagrantino Secco, a dry red, and Montefalco Sagrantino Passito, a sweet red. Traditionally, this grape was almost exclusively vinified in the latter style, or blended with other wines to add strength. Increasingly, however, the class of Sagrantino as a stand-alone variety is being recognised and it is being used to make good quality dry wines. Sagrantino di Montefalco is not obliged by law to come from the commune of Montefalco, but it must be grown in the province of Perugia in Umbria
Region: Montefalco is a small town in the southern Apennines, in Umbria which is south-east of Tuscany. It is here that the work of two significant local producers, Arnaldo Caprai and Paolo Bea (whose wines we offered to Bowes Wine clients some months ago), has led to Sagrantino di Montefalco being promoted to DOCG status. (DOCG - Denominazione de Origine Controllata e Garantita: the highest quality level.)
Producer: In 1997, Vaglie was still a small family firm yet the estate has now expanded to 115 hectares. Their aim is to offer traditional wines of good value

Tasting Notes:
A very deep ruby red colour.
Nose is starting to mature and gives off scents of dry spice and ink, plus earth and cherries, both red and black.
The palate is beautifully concentrated, fresh. It quickly becomes serious and structured; rich, serious, fine and tacky tannins drag the tongue forward through the very long finish. I cannot help but think that this is a great deal of wine for the money. This could easily hold its own against a field of top cru bourgeois claret and one wouldn't be ashamed of producing a bottle for a very smart dinner.
